TVRs converge on Blackpool

There'll be hundreds of TVRs converging on Blackpool tomorrow, heading for the huge party being thrown for the benefit of TVR's ex-workers.

But if you haven't bought your tickets, then it's too late, as the closing date was a week ago. The party, dubbed ThunderBall, which will happen at the Blackpool's Winter Gardens, looks set to be huge.

According to organiser David Hughes: "We are now expecting a staggering 550 to 600 attendees, for what could be the last time the workers are gathered together in one place. In addition to the attractions of a live band, disco, food, drink and great company, we have received donations of more than 40 prizes, from generous supporters which will be raffled on the night.

"There are convoys arranged from all corners of the country, synchronised to converge in Blackpool at the same time on Saturday afternoon. The day after the party, even more TVR owners will be joining the ThunderBall attendees for a parade drive to the old factory in Bristol Avenue, for a last photocall at the home of TVR before heading off in convoy for a drive around the Trough of Bowland."
